CEPA General Assembly in Brussels

25.01.2015

Representatives of Secspector Int. and UPCA (Ukrainian Pest Control Association) took part in the meeting of the General Assembly of CEPA (Confederation of European Pest Management Associations).

 

The Confederation of European Pest Management Associations (CEPA) is an association of national pest control associations in Europe and the world, manufacturers, distributors of products and service organizations of pest control. The purpose of its activities is to consolidate the efforts of its members in the exchange of experience, information and best practices in the field of pest control.

 

On January 20, 2015, in Brussels, representatives of Secspector Int. and UPCA took part in the meeting of the EPA General Assembly, where the following issues were discussed:

  1. Presentation of the report on the work done in 2014;
  2. Announcement of the action plan and budget of the organization for 2015;
  3. Release of the new European standard EN 16636, which will regulate the requirements and recommendations for the provision of Pest Control services;
  4. Presentation of the CEPA Certified certification scheme.
  5. Consideration of applications for new members.

 

After the voting, the Ukrainian Pest Control Association was accepted as a member of CEPA by a unanimous decision. “We sincerely believe that Ukraine’s accession to the international level in the pest control sphere will help Ukrainian pest control companies – UPCA members to significantly improve their professional level and bring their methods and standards of work in line with the European ones” – said the President of the Ukrainian Pest Control Association Sergey Krivodonov.
